JAVA写Excel 多列
总体流程
首先,我们需要使用JAVA语言中的一些库来操作Excel文件。在这里我们使用Apache POI库来实现。下面是实现“JAVA写Excel 多列”的整体流程:
步骤 | 操作 |
---|---|
1 | 创建一个Excel工作簿 |
2 | 创建一个工作表 |
3 | 创建行和列 |
4 | 写入数据 |
5 | 保存Excel文件 |
详细步骤和代码
步骤 1:创建一个Excel工作簿
首先,我们需要创建一个Excel工作簿对象,这可以通过HSSFWorkbook类来实现。
// 创建一个Excel工作簿
HSSFWorkbook workbook = new HSSFWorkbook();
步骤 2:创建一个工作表
接下来,我们需要在工作簿中创建一个工作表对象,这可以通过HSSFSheet类来实现。
// 创建一个工作表
HSSFSheet sheet = workbook.createSheet("Sheet1");
步骤 3:创建行和列
然后,我们需要在工作表中创建行和列,这可以通过HSSFRow和HSSFCell类来实现。
// 创建第一行
HSSFRow row = sheet.createRow(0);
// 创建第一列
HSSFCell cell = row.createCell(0);
步骤 4:写入数据
接着,我们可以写入数据到指定的行和列,这可以通过setCellValue方法来实现。
// 写入数据到第一行第一列
cell.setCellValue("Data1");
步骤 5:保存Excel文件
最后,我们需要将工作簿中的内容写入到一个Excel文件中,并保存起来。
// 将内容写入到Excel文件
FileOutputStream fileOut = new FileOutputStream("output.xlsx");
workbook.write(fileOut);
fileOut.close();
类图
classDiagram
HSSFWorkbook <|-- HSSFSheet
HSSFSheet *-- HSSFRow
HSSFRow *-- HSSFCell
通过以上步骤和代码,你可以实现“JAVA写Excel 多列”的功能。希望对你有帮助!祝你学习进步!